Carbon storage has become a critical component of the energy industry and understanding geomechanical effects is essential for mitigating risk. This course gives an overview of geomechanics modelling with a particular focus on ccs. Basic geomechanics concepts will be reviewed as well as how to implement them using CMG software. Practical CCS examples will investigated including using geomechanics to determine cap rock integrity and potential fault reactivation

Course Content

  • Review basic mechanical concepts and equations
  • Coupling geomechanics to a flow simulator
  • Finite elements
  • Boundary and initial conditions
  • Yield functions
  • Constitutive laws
  • Dual grid system
  • Barton-Bandis fracture permeability
  • Caprock leakage
  • Fault reactivation
